Trends in the Traditional Bicycle Industry: Classic Revival and Innovative Upgrade

Amid the rising awareness of green mobility and upgraded consumer demands, traditional bicycles have not been overshadowed by electric vehicles. Instead, they are regaining vitality through continuous innovation, securing a firm position in urban commuting, outdoor leisure, family interactions, and other scenarios. Blending classic charm with modern upgrades, the industry is moving toward lightweight, practicality, aesthetics, and sustainability.

Lightweight material innovation reshapes the core riding experience. Aluminum alloy, with its balanced performance, accounts for 75% of traditional bicycle frames, becoming the mainstream choice. Advanced scandium alloy is 15% lighter than traditional aluminum while enhancing rigidity, enabling mid-range models to deliver premium riding quality. Carbon fiber accessories like forks have penetrated mid-range bikes with a 40% rate, effectively reducing riding fatigue. Meanwhile, steel-frame bicycles are experiencing a retro revival—aerospace-grade welding technology trims the weight of chromoly steel frames to 1.2kg, combining classic texture with modern practicality.

Functional integration meets urban commuting needs. Fenders, rear racks, and LED lights have become factory-installed standards, with some models adding USB charging ports and storage baskets. Internal 3-speed hubs, boasting a 5,000-kilometer maintenance-free cycle, simplify usage and lower costs. Hidden brake cables and quick-release designs enhance convenience and adaptability to diverse road conditions.

Design aesthetics drive consumption upgrades. Retro models with brass accessories and leather seats see a 28% year-on-year sales growth, while minimalist chainless shaft-driven bikes capture 15% of the high-end commuter market. Ergonomic frame optimization fits 85% of height ranges, reducing riding fatigue by 30%.

Scenario segmentation activates new growth engines. Children’s bikes under 20 inches adopt lightweight magnesium alloy wheels and puncture-resistant tires (90% penetration rate) for safety and ease of use. Family-oriented models like tandem bikes and parent-child trailers sell over one million units annually, with foldable designs saving 60% storage space.

Sustainability becomes an industry consensus. Eighty percent of brands use water-based paint, cutting VOC emissions by 70%. Recycled aluminum is widely applied, and the 92% recovery rate of scrapped frames supports a circular economy. Modular designs extend product lifecycles by enabling component replacement.
